Decoding the Trending Style Journey – From TikTok to IRL
The influence of TikTok on contemporary fashion is significant, prompting a fascinating and accelerated style cycle. What once took months to trickle down from runways to retail is now happening in weeks, even days. This “TikTok to IRL” phenomenon sees micro-trends, rooted in viral videos showcasing specific aesthetics, quickly gaining the attention of millions. The immediacy of the platform – with its ability to highlight specific items or looks – directly drives a consumer desire that extends far beyond its digital origin, manifesting in real-world wardrobes and shaping the broader fashion landscape. Ultimately, this transformation illustrates a seismic shift in how fashion is identified and adopted.
Deconstructing Trending Aesthetics Deconstruction: The Anatomy of an Digital Trend
What makes a fashion moment explode across the web? It’s rarely just about a single piece – it's the confluence of several factors. Typically, a trend originates from a smaller corner, potentially a TikTok dance challenge or an influencer's unique presentation. Early visibility is often boosted by algorithmic recommendations, which presents it to a wider following. Subsequently, cultural impact—whether it’s nostalgia, a sense of belonging, or a simple need for self-expression—fuels quick embracing. In conclusion, the trend finds its place perpetuated through community content, creating a beneficial response loop that even more amplifies its reach and eventually cements its place in the shifting sphere of online aesthetics.
